Grey Water Safe?1 answer
Are these grey water safe?
Bet - Tawonga South, 3698(4 years ago)
G'day Bet,
Your toilet should be emptied straight into a dump point or septic tank. They are septic safe, but generally, greywater is wastewater from the shower/bath/handbasin, and toilet water is referred to as blackwater.

Are the tablets to be used in the flush water and storage water?1 answer
Just wanting to know if the tablets are to be used in the top flush water and storage water or just storage water? If only in storage water do you need any other chemical in the flush water. Sorry a bit confused.
Alyssa - Taigum(6 years ago)
G'day Alyssa,
The Odour-B-Gone tablets are designed to be used in the holding tank not the flush tank. You don't need chemical in the flush tank, but if you wanted to use one the Thetford Aqua Rinse (Pink) or Dometic Extra Care Rinse Water Additive would be the best options.

Is this solid disk the same as a liquid sanitizer?1 answer
If it does the same job and deodorises, would be much easier for storage than a liquid sanitiser.
Max - TORQUAY, QLD(9 years ago)
Hi Max, generally a sanitiser is used in the flush water tank of your portaloo to clean and sanitize the bowl/basin. The Odour B Gone tabs are for use in the waste water tank, and they are a suitable replacement for liquid waste water treatments. I hope this makes sense.
